Artemis II astronauts return to Earth
The Verge·
The Artemis II crew is returning to Earth after a nine-day mission, having traveled farther from our planet than any humans before. Commander Reid Wiseman, Pilot Victor Glover, Mission Specialist Christina Koch, and Canadian Astronaut Jeremy Hansen are expected to splash down in the Pacific Ocean on April 10th. The Orion capsule will make a high-speed re-entry, with Navy recovery crews on standby to assist the astronauts aboard the USS John P. Murtha for immediate medical checks before their return to land. This mission marks a significant milestone in human space exploration.
